NEXT month will be two years since iconic actor and comedian Robin Williams died.
This week he would have turned 65, and his daughter Zelda Williams marked the occasion by posting a touching tribute to her dad.
“Still not really sure what to do on days like today,” she wrote on Instagram alongside a black and white family photo.
“ … I know I can’t give you a present anymore, but I guess that means I’ll just have to keep giving them in your name instead. This year, I tried to help three causes you cared about in one; rescue dogs, people suffering from disabilities, and our nation’s wounded veterans, so I donated to freedomservicedogs.org.
“They rescue pups from shelters and train them so that they can be paired with someone in dire need of their help and companionship. Thought you’d get a kick out of furry, four legged friends helping change the world, one warrior in need at a time. Happy birthday Poppo. Shasha, Zakky, Codeman and I all love you and miss you like crazy. Xo”
Just days before his death in 2014, Williams posted his own birthday message to his daughter.
“Happy birthday to Ms. Zelda Rae Williams! Quarter of a century old today but always my baby girl,” he captioned a photo of them together.
